| FlowJo is littered with help buttons throughout the application. Clicking on one of these launches a web browser to access the web page describing that topic. Where are the help pages? FlowJo uses a standard HTML hypertext format for its documentation, and relies on your web browser to read it. FlowJo looks for help pages in one of two locations: first, in a folder called "Documentation" that should be in the same folder as the application. If this folder exists, then FlowJo directs your browser to get its information from that folder. If FlowJo does not find a "Documentation" folder, it will access the reference manual page over the net. The "Documentation" folder can be found on
the FlowJo CD or you can download it from the web onto your Macintosh.
